Output 59d9eb5f661b28364f620e59fb97763488f633b14dd8dcf8643cb8638d9b1d8f:71

value
29865960
script pubkey
OP_0 OP_PUSHBYTES_20 305be6f1a33bd9f3058331a050abcf6336f04d8a
address
bc1qxpd7dudr80vlxpvrxxs9p270vvm0qnv2ewq5rj
transaction
59d9eb5f661b28364f620e59fb97763488f633b14dd8dcf8643cb8638d9b1d8f
confirmations
2024
spent
true